Oracle數(shù)據(jù)庫備份與恢復(fù)的方法包括以下幾種:
物理備份(Physical Backup):物理備份是對數(shù)據(jù)庫文件的直接備份,包括數(shù)據(jù)文件、控制文件和日志文件。常見的物理備份方法包括使用操作系統(tǒng)命令復(fù)制數(shù)據(jù)庫文件、使用RMAN(Recovery Manager)工具進行備份等。
邏輯備份(Logical Backup):邏輯備份是對數(shù)據(jù)庫中的邏輯結(jié)構(gòu)進行備份,包括表、索引、存儲過程等。邏輯備份方法通常使用數(shù)據(jù)泵(Data Pump)工具或EXP/IMP工具進行備份。
歸檔日志備份(Archive Log Backup):歸檔日志備份是對數(shù)據(jù)庫中的歸檔日志進行備份,用于在數(shù)據(jù)庫恢復(fù)時還原到備份時的狀態(tài)。歸檔日志備份通常使用RMAN工具進行備份。
在線備份(Online Backup):在線備份是在數(shù)據(jù)庫運行期間進行備份,不會中斷數(shù)據(jù)庫的正常運行。在線備份通常使用RMAN工具進行。
熱備份(Hot Backup):熱備份是在數(shù)據(jù)庫運行期間進行備份,與在線備份類似,不會中斷數(shù)據(jù)庫的正常運行。熱備份通常使用RMAN工具進行。
冷備份(Cold Backup):冷備份是在數(shù)據(jù)庫關(guān)閉狀態(tài)下進行備份,需要停止數(shù)據(jù)庫的運行。冷備份通常使用操作系統(tǒng)命令進行。
在恢復(fù)數(shù)據(jù)庫時,可以根據(jù)備份的類型和方法選擇相應(yīng)的恢復(fù)方法,如使用RMAN工具進行物理備份的恢復(fù),使用數(shù)據(jù)泵工具進行邏輯備份的恢復(fù)等。同時,還可以根據(jù)需求選擇全量恢復(fù)、增量恢復(fù)、點恢復(fù)等不同的恢復(fù)策略。